Common 7.3L Powerstroke Up-Pipe Failure Symptoms
If your 7.3L Powerstroke truck is showing any of these symptoms, the factory crush-donut up-pipes are most likely the cause:
- Exhaust leak at the Y-pipe / turbo pedestal — telltale "tick tick tick" under the hood at idle or under boost
- Lazy spool and reduced boost — leaking up-pipes bleed off pre-turbine drive pressure, dropping peak boost and slowing turbo response
- Elevated EGTs and reduced fuel economy — ECM compensates for lost boost with more fuel, raising exhaust gas temps
- Black sooting at the manifold or Y-pipe joints — visible carbon trails at every gasket interface where the seal has broken
Why 304SS Bellowed Up-Pipes Outlast OEM
The factory International up-pipes use crush-donut gaskets that break their seal under normal thermal cycling — every heat cycle the pipes expand and contract, loading the crush donuts until they lose their seal for good. SPOOLOGIC pipes are mandrel-bent 304 stainless steel with bellowed expansion joints that flex with heat expansion, taking that stress off the sealing surface entirely. Flat-flange design with metal crush gaskets, TIG-welded flanges, ceramic-coated ductile iron Y-pipe collector — engineered to hold a permanent seal.
